I currently live in a building called "Flats 130" which is on the corner of 1st and M ST NE. It's about a 10 minute walk to GULC and is about 10 seconds away from the Noma/galludet metro stop (red line). I pay about 1200 per month + utilities and absolutely love it. Building was built in 2010 and the faciltiies (gym etc.) are great. Unfortunately not between the two campuses

Thought I'd post since I had trouble finding the type of housing I was looking for last year a small apartment building or townhouse. If you want new an shiny there are many great, easy to find options along Mass Ave.
I found an affordable (in DC) apartment in a 1940s apartment building (wood floors, big windows, corner) through Yarmouth Management.
http://yarmouthmanagement.com/today.html To be honest, they have a mañana attitude about maintenance. It get's done, but may take a while. BUT they are the very drilled into the Capitol Hill rental market, including the areas east and south of GULC. There are a couple of GULC students that rent in my building.
